How does one obtain an opinion that there are no qualified workers available from the
Labor Department quickly enough to utilize this category?

Even though premium processing is available from INS, if it takes 2 years plus to get
a response from State DOL and the job is for less than one year's duration, it
doesn't seem to make sense.

Is H2B not truly a viable option or am I misunderstanding something?

Temporary labor certifications and permanent labor certifications have different
timelines. See www.ows.doleta.go-
v/foreign/times.asp
. There are different columns for the different types of
certification.
